Planting Calendar for Dianthus

Frost tolerance for dianthus: Tolerant of some frost.
When to plant: Up to 5 weeks before last frost.

Dianthus are moderately cold tolerant which means that you can get them planted earlier than other frost tender plants.

The earliest that you can plant dianthus in Key Biscayne is January. However, you really should wait until February if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ant dianthus and expect a good harvest is probably November. You probably don't want to wait any later than that or else your dianthus may not have a chance to grow to maturity. If you are starting your dianthus indoors then you might be able to get away with starting them a few weeks earlier.

Last Frost Date

In Key Biscayne it never frosts. You can expect an average low temperature of 40°F in the coldest months of winter.

It's important to remember that USDA zone info for Key Biscayne is not always accurate and the actual date of last frost is different every year. Since it never frosts in Key Biscayne you do not have to be ready to protect your dianthus if you have a late frost.
